The whole situation is a mess. It is sensitive and we're working with them. We both want to see the value of this coin grow and yes launching something this dramatically different than other coins is a difficult undertaking, the team (Syscoin) underestimated the scale of this undertaking and yes there were issues at launch which we resolved as quickly as possible and now things are working correctly. For those asking about roadmaps or no clear path forward - this is why we are locking this thread and moving to a new one. We have posted this information multiple times but its been lost in the avalanche of pages here. To reiterate, and this will be clearly posted in the new thread later today [ROADMAP]:- Merged Mining and Service fee regeneration (we are working on this now on testnet, we have regen working and MM but there was an issue with MM + services which we're ironing out right now). <- this will constitute the NEXT release aka 0.1.4 and will happen very soon, we're not launching things without overly testing now. - ESCROW. We already have stubs in the code and this is the next feature to be implemented - END TO END ENCRYPTION USING SYSCOIN KEYS - This is after escrow - SERVICE FEE SCHEDULE FINALIZATION (after 90 day period, dynamic pricing will go into effect) - QT WALLET IMPROVEMENTS (services in wallet, with nice UIs) - (in parallel with the above, the non-C devs on the team): Building web-based service demos on top of all our four launch services all of which are properly functioning. The above represents a 1-3month roadmap and will be clear in the new post, which will be up later today we were drafting it yesterday but then focused on Merged-mining later in the day. BTW we totally agree with this- we want to grow value in a real way. Not though walls and price manipulation. We already spent 250btc of the fund on buy support and Moolah is holding that SYS as per the payout schedule communicated earlier. What remains of the fund will be pushed toward additional dev, scaling the team, bringing on FT devs and a community manager to join the existing team and continue executing and expediting the roadmap outlined in my last post. We have 3 new devs we've brought on since launch but have paused growing the team further until we have some of the funding in place which should happen shortly.
